Clara Adriana Hendrika Herrygers

September 28, 1944 - March 9, 2026

Peacefully at home on Monday, March 9, 2026, in her 82nd year. Beloved sister of Maria Hendrickson (the late Claude), Gus Herrygers (Sandy), Cecile Lackie (the late Wayne), and predeceased by her sisters Francine Wry (Ken) and Lucy Kannstadter. Loving aunt of Karl Kannstadter (Angie), Helga Wybrow (Chris), Jeff Wry, Gary Wry, Michael Wry, Jennifer Lackie, Judy Temple (Craig), Scott Herrygers and Connie Herrygers. Clara will be sadly missed by her many great nieces, great nephews and close neighbours who provided extraordinary community support. Following Clara’s request, cremation has taken place.
Donations to the charity of your choice would be appreciated.
